Description
For over 50 years, Basic Blueprint Reading and Sketching has been an international best-seller and THE definitive resource for blueprint reading. Basic Blueprint Reading and Sketching 9th Edition continues the traditions that have helped over 50 million students achieve competence in reading and sketching technical drawings. This classic interactive book/workbook will help users develop skills in reading and interpreting industrial drawings and preparing basic to advanced technical sketches. This book will provide them with basic principles, concepts, ANSI and SI Metric drafting symbols and standards, terminology, manufacturing process notes, and other related technical information contained on a mechanical or CAD drawing. Each unit features a basic principle and at least one blueprint and assignment that encourages students to practice newly learned skills. this edition contains coverage of the latest ANSI, ISO, AWS and ASME standards.

From the Preface
Almost all engineers, technicians, architects, machinists, mechanics, and persons whose jobs are related to manufacturing, transportation, construction, and fabrication - from designers to after-market sales persons - frequently refer to blueprints (a copy of any original technical drawing). The written word is insufficient to communicate physical facts completely and accurately. They must be supplemented by graphical representations (drawings). One may never need to make a technical drawing, but all must be able to read and understand them or be professionally illiterate.
This text, Basic Blueprint Reading and Sketching, covers all the basic content and exercises to make someone a competent reader of blueprints. It also uniquely covers the increasing need to be able to accurately make technical sketches.
The current edition carries on the traditions that have helped an estimated 58 million users, over its lifetime, to achieve competence in reading and sketching technical drawings as no other book in its field has been able to do. It is the most used blueprint reading book because of the ‘hands-on experiences’ of the authors and because of Dr. C. Thomas Olivo’s original occupational analysis and his writing and organizational skills that are continued by Thomas P. Olivo. In addition, the recommendations by the publisher’s reviewers and the author’s diverse team of consultants provide continued adjustments to revise the depth and breadth of its content.
Table of Contents:
Section 1: Lines.
Chapter 1: Bases for Blueprint Reading and Sketching. Chapter 2: The Alphabet of Lines and Object Lines. Chapter 3: Hidden Lines and Center Lines. Chapter 4: Extension Lines and Dimension Lines. Chapter 5: Projection Lines and Line Combinations.
Section 2: Views.
Chapter 6: Three-View Drawings. Chapter 7: Arrangement of Views. Chapter 8: Two-View Drawings. Chapter 9: One-View Drawings. Chapter 10: Auxiliary Views.
Section 3: Dimensions and Notes.
Chapter 11: Size and Location Dimensions. Chapter 12: Dimensioning Cylinders, Circles, and Arcs. Chapter 13: Size Dimensions for Holes and Angles. Chapter 14: Location Dimensions for Points, Centers, and Holes. Chapter 15: Dimensioning Large Arcs and Base Line Dimensions. Chapter 16: Tolerances: Fractional and Angular Dimensions. Chapter 17: Unilateral, Lateral, Decimal, Tolerances and Limits. Chapter 18: Interchangeable Parts, Allowances and Classes of Fit. Chapter 19: Representing and Dimensioning External Screw Threads. Chapter 20: Representing and Specifying Internal and Left-Hand Threads. Chapter 21: Dimensioning Tapers and Machined Surfaces. Chapter 22: Dimensioning with Shop Notes.
Section 4: The SI Metric System.
Chapter 23: Metric System Dimensioning and ISO Symbols. Chapter 24: First-Angle Projection and Dimensioning. Chapter 25: Metric Screw Threads, Dual Dimensioning, and Tolerancing.
Section 5: Sections.
Chapter 26: Cutting Planes, Full Sections, and Section Lining. Chapter 27: Half Sections, Partial Sections, and Full-Section Assembly Drawings.
Section 6: Computer Numerical Control (CNC) Fundamentals.
Chapter 28: Datums: Ordinate and Tabular Dimensioning.
Section 7: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ing.
Chapter 29: Geometric Dimensioning, Tolerancing, and Datum Referencing.
Section 8: Computer Graphics Technology.
Chapter 30: CADD/CAM/CIM and Robotics.
Section 9: Specialty Drawings.
Chapter 31: Welding Symbols, Representation, and Dimensioning. Chapter 32: Surface Developments and Precision Sheet Metal Drawings.
Section 10: Working Drawings.
Chapter 33: Detail Drawings and Assembly Drawings.
Section 11: Sketching Lines and Basic Forms.
Chapter 34: Sketching Horizontal, Vertical, and Slant Lines. Chapter 35: Sketching Curved Lines and Circles. Chapter 36: Sketching Irregular Shapes. Chapter 37: Sketching Fillets, Radii, and Rounded Corners and Edges.
Section 12: Freehand Lettering.
Chapter 38: Freehand Vertical Lettering. Chapter 39: Freehand Inclined Lettering.
Section 13: Shop Sketching: Pictorial Drawings.
Chapter 40: Orthographic Sketching. Chapter 41: Oblique Sketching. Chapter 42: Isometric Sketching. Chapter 43: Perspective Sketching. Chapter 44: Pictorial Drawings and Dimensions.
Section 14: Sketching for CAD/CNC.
Chapter 45: Two-Dimensional and Three-Dimensional CAD Sketching. Chapter 46: Proportions and Assembly Drawings. Glossary of Select Terms. Index.
